Q: Can I repair a split window myself?A: Small fractures can frequently be fixed with clear epoxy resin. However, bigger cracks might need professional repair or replacement to make sure security and prevent more damage.
Q: How do I understand if I need to replace a window pane?A: If the window is fogged, has extensive fractures, or is shattered, replacement is generally necessary. Furthermore, if the glass belongs to a double-glazed unit and the seal has actually stopped working, replacement is frequently the very best option.
Q: Are there any safety precautions I should take when managing damaged glass?A: Yes, always use protective gloves and safety glasses when handling damaged glass. Utilize a durable container to dispose of the glass to avoid injury. If the damage is substantial, prevent touching the glass completely and call a professional.
Q: What is the cost of expert glass repair?A: The expense of expert glass repair can vary extensively depending on the type and degree of the damage, the size of the glass, and the place. Typically, small repairs can cost between ₤ 50 and ₤ 100, while complete replacements can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500 or more.
Q: Can I use regular super glue to repair glass?A: While super glue can sometimes work for minor repairs, it is not developed for usage on glass and might not provide a strong, lasting bond. Clear epoxy resin is a better choice for glass repairs.
Q: How do I avoid fogged windows?A: Fogged windows are generally triggered by a stopped working seal in double-glazed units. To prevent this, make sure that the seals are intact and replace any broken seals immediately. Additionally, keeping the windows well-ventilated can help in reducing condensation.
